That's an amazing planet shot! How'd you manage to create that? Which program did you use? I'd love to try my hand at that.

James
It's all Photoshop. :)

I used the Flaming Pear "Lunarcell" plugin to build the outline of the landforms, and I used parts of Earth and Mars texture maps to add detail to the landmasses. I got a really huge cloud map from a friend, overlaid it, and used it to cast a shadow.The big shadow is just a layer on top of the planet, and the atmospheric glow is the same way. After all of that, I copy out a round part, (up until now its all a rectangular image) and then use the "Spherize" filter to make it look round. After about 10 tries, that's what I arrived at. :) The only problem I have with this method, is that if the image of the planet is REALLY big, you can get some pixellation around the edges.
